Could it be?  After years of lacking neighborhood amenities, the Seaport District could be getting a new public park.  And not just a dinky little square of green space but a full on park.  According to Curbed Boston, WS Development is proposing a 1.5 acre park complete with climbable boulders, a playground and sugar maple trees that will make syrup!  Well, the Southie syrup alone is enough to have us excited. 

This park is part of a larger proposal for a almost 13-acre project called Seaport Square!
